PAGG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2013 in Review

25 of the 3,445 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co Global Agriculture ETF (PAGG) for Q4 2013, worth a combined $48.2M — up 5.6% from $45.7M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 3 funds opened new PAGG posit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 3 holders — while 8 added to existing stakes and 11 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Susquehanna International Group, adding an estimated $1.22M. The largest seller was Invesco, cutting an estimated $1.6M.
